Feeding the Pigeons - A Nostalgic Glimpse into Childhood Delights
EDITORS COMMENTS
. This chromolitho print, titled "Feeding the Pigeons" takes us back to a bygone era of innocence and simplicity. Created by George Henry Edwards in the late 19th century, this delightful illustration was featured in The Little Ones Own Coloured Picture Paper, a cherished publication from that time. In this scene, we see two young girls dressed in Victorian fashion, their ribbons fluttering as they eagerly feed pigeons on a quaint farm. Armed with bows and arrows, these children exude both curiosity and playfulness as they interact with nature's creatures. The idyllic farmhouse serves as a backdrop for this charming tableau. The artist skillfully captures the joyous spirit of childhood through his vibrant colors and attention to detail. Each pigeon is rendered with precision, showcasing their unique beauty against the rustic landscape.
